Early rates of successful recanalization (SR) of distal vessel occlusions (DVO) following intravenous thrombolysis (IVT) between alteplase (ALT) and tenecteplase (TNK) are poorly known.
From March 2016 to February 2020, consecutive stroke patients hospitalized in the stroke unit of the Sud-Francilien Hospital with DVO identified on baseline MRI and suitable for IVT but not for mechanical thrombectomy will be included. In our stroke unit, patients were treated with ALT, 0.9 mg/kg from March 2016 to February 2018 and then with TNK, 0.25 mg/kg from March 2018 to December 2023. MRI was controlled 1-2 hours within IVT (MRI-2). Early recanalization was assessed on an adapted Arterial Occlusion Lesion (AOL) scale, SR being defined as AOL 2/3 scores on MRI-2. The rate reduction of thrombus length (TL) when thrombus persisted, the IVT response threshold of TL and the infarct size evolution were also assessed. In the present study, the investigators sought to compare early rates of SR between the two lytics, based on a retrospective analysis of magnetic resonance imaging (MRI) performed early after IVT.

Intravenous thrombolysis with Alteplase (0.9 mg/kg, maximum 90 mg) with 10% of the dose given as a bolus followed by an infusion lasting 60 minutes.
Intravenous thrombolysis with Tenecteplase (0.25mg/kg, maximum 25 mg) with 100% of the dose given as a bolus.

Thrombus length (TL) was approximated by measuring the susceptibility vessel sign (SVS) on the susceptibility weight angiography (SWAN) sequence.
TL were measured in the 3 spatial planes, the higher value being retained. When thrombus persisted on MRI-2, TL reduction was assessed as follows : (MRI-1 length - MRI-2 length)/MRI-1 length X 100.

Volume of the ischemic lesion will be assessed on the diffusion-weighted imaging (DWI) sequence using an automated software (Olea software).
This evolution of cerebral infarct volume will be calculated as follows : DWI MRI volume n°2 - initial DWI MRI volume.
